The Diversity Award recognizes a staff or faculty member who has demonstrated, through his or her positive interactions with others, a respect and value for differing backgrounds and points of view within the Duke University and Duke University Health System community.
Eligibility
- Permanent, full-time staff or faculty.
- Free from any disciplinary dctions for the last five years.
- Previous Diversity Award winners are not eligible for nomination.
- Nominations may be made by staff or faculty members at any level.
- Nomination packet is not acceptable without an authorized signature.
Criteria
Nominees should exhibit the following:
- A demonstrated commitment to the spirit of diversity.
- Leadership which fosters positive interaction between persons of different cultural backgrounds.
- Consistently behaved in a manner which illustrates a commitment to the inclusion of persons within the institution who are members of traditionally underrepresented groups.
Presentation
- Diversity Award winner(s) and their guests will be invited to a ceremony in the fall.
- Diversity Award winners(s) will be presented with a bound copy of the nomination, an engraved crystal bowl and a check for $750.
Nomination Process
- All nominations should be completed via nomination form found on the Diversity Award website when nominations are accepted.
- Award recipients will be selected by a committee appointed by the Assistant Vice President for Work Environment in Human Resources.
- Nominations will be open from mid-August to late August. Exact dates and deadlines will posted on the Diversity Award website.
- All nominees, including the Diversity Award winners, will be notified by early October.
